Kadali, Talala

Kadali is a village located in the Talala Taluk of Gir Somnath district of Gujarat. The village falls in Talala block. It belongs to Junagadh parliament constituency and Talala assembly constituency.

As on May 2024, the current population of Kadali is 28 out of which 16 are males and rest 12 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 750 females per 1000 males. There are around 5 teenagers in Kadali. It has literacy rate of 21% which means around 6 persons can read and write. Total 0 people belonging to scheduled caste and 0 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 5 households in Kadali, which means every family has 6 members on average. The village has working population of 7. The pincode of Kadali is 362135 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
